We get more concerned when symptoms: Persist (hours to days) or steadily worsen Recur in a predictable pattern (for example, nightly burning in the feet) Are associated with weakness, clumsiness, balance problems, or pain Are one-sided and sudden (particularly when paired with speech, vision, or facial changes) Occur alongside signs of dehydration or poor intake (lightheadedness, palpitations, very dark urine, inability to keep fluids down) Because Ozempic can significantly change appetite and digestion, it can indirectly create conditions that make paresthesia more likely, even if the medication isn't the primary culprit
